How they compare
Kyrgyzstan currently reports 15.5% against 13.2% in Belarus, a difference of 2.3%.
That makes Kyrgyzstan's figure about 1.2 times Belarus's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 8 shared years of data; in 2012 it was Belarus ahead.
Belarus ranks 16th and Kyrgyzstan ranks 13th of 26 countries.

About this data
Percentage of benefits going to the third quintile relative to the total benefits going to the population
